A bug was found with the experience calculation for winning a duel vs. a member of the clan ruling the town you are in. Extra XP was being rewarded. As much as I hate making changes to the game after an official launch, especially with regards to xp, I felt it was worth it due to the nature of bug to fix it.
Sorry for the issue. Some players XP are slightly inflated from where they really should be, but there's no way to tell exactly who and how much. The only way to even things out properly would be a reset, which I don't think is quite necessary. Really, the bug was mostly unknown and doesn't appear to have been exploited purposefully, so for the most part it was just luck that for those that got the bonus.
